Transaction 5c3bc3227963701cc1602ee9e82b6d11bfb3cd3d7eb199137e8ea8e9451e61a4
1 Input
1 Output
-
5c3bc3227963701cc1602ee9e82b6d11bfb3cd3d7eb199137e8ea8e9451e61a4:0
- value
- 655174
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c21819361857bc1cae3586195deca86aa5d6170e OP_EQUAL
- address
- 3KPHt9hGBCgWDDzZm6w2s4US7PBaocKiN6